Which Dennis Wheatley Books Were Made Into Films?

Answer Question

1 Answer - Sort by: Date | Rating

    Dennis Wheatley was born in London and was in the list of Worlds best selling authors from the year 1950 to 1960. A 'Hammer Film Production' made five of his novels into films. The names of these movies are listed below.
    Forbidden Territory
    Secret of Stamboul
    The Devil Rides Out
    The Last Continent
    To The Devil—A Daughter

    Out of these the most famous movie was 'The Devil Rides Out'. Although Dennis Wheatley had written five original movie scripts, none of them were ever taken into consideration. It is also said that the very famous 'Alfred Hitchcock' was making one Wheatley's novel 'The Forbidden Territory' into a movie. But for some reason the plans never worked out. He was a well-read individual with interests varying in a wide range of topics from continental Europe to Historical fiction.
